Description
Though at first glance the natural world may appear overwhelming in its diversity and complexity, there are regularities running thr ough it, from the hexagons of a honeycomb to the spirals of a seashell and the branching veins of a leaf. Revealing the order at the foundation of the seemingly chaotic natural world, Patterns in Nature explores not only the math and science but also the beauty an d artistry behind natures awe-inspiring designs.
